Voice of OC: Santa Ana’s lucrative trash contract has been extended for 22 years without competition

Santa Ana City Council members, following a decades-old pattern of not seeking competitive bids for its home and business trash collection contract, have delayed competition to the point where Waste Management, Inc.’s contract from 1993 – which was originally set to expire in 1998 – will continue until the year 2020.

CalPensions: CalPERS stays the course on rates, investing risk

Last December CalPERS lowered its investment earnings forecast used to discount future pension costs from 7.5 to 7 percent. To replace the lower expected earnings, local government rate increases begin next year and slowly increase until 2024.

Sac Bee: Trump Files SCOTUS Brief Against Unions in Janus v AFSCME

A decision against AFSCME would forbid public employee unions from collecting so-called “fair share” fees from workers who do not want to join labor groups but benefit from representation. California is one of 22 states that allow public employee unions to charge them.
